Head to head by decade

Decade Panama Samoa Difference Ahead
1900s 2.57 0 2.57 Panama
1910s 3 0 3 Panama
1920s 2.6 1.2 1.4 Panama
1930s 3.4 2 1.4 Panama
1940s 2.8 2 0.8 Panama
1950s 2.6 2 0.6 Panama
1960s 4.8 3.6 1.2 Panama
1970s 0.8 4 3.2 Samoa
1980s 2.4 4 1.6 Samoa
1990s 6 7 1 Samoa
2000s 7 7 0
2010s 7 7 0
2020s 7 7 0

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Identifies the political regime of a country. It distinguishes between non-electoral autocracies (score 0), one-party autocracies (score 1), multi-party autocracies without elected executive (score 2), multi-party autocracies (score 3), exclusive democracies (score 4), male democracies (score 5), electoral democracies (score 6), and full democracies (score 7).
